So I bought this little lcd tv on a fleamarket. It was really cheap and judging by the looks of it, I guess it was used in a store to advertise "roundup".
The screen is 18 cm diagonal (7.2 inch) and takes SD and USB input. It also has a potentiometer on the side which controls the volume on the integrated speaker.
On power up it displays the roundup logo and if nothing is in either of the two slots, the menu screen appears. Judging from it there should have been a remote with it but I don't have that.
My question is if this screen could be used for a portable nes laptop I'm going to make. Included are several pictures but if more are needed please tell me

Nope the screens take digital RGB and the system on a chip has the lcd controller built into it. You could probably use it for playing movies off a SD card but that's about it. No analog video anywhere.
